Don Osito Marquina is the name of a little teddy bear that Salvador Dalí’s parents brought home from Paris for their two little boys. Now it is the title of a picture book that is a brief diary beautifully illustrated by Zuzanna Celej, telling the story about the little stuffed bear.
The Dalí brothers welcomed the bear as one more member of the family. When the poet García Lorca visited the family, he realized just how much he meant to them and chose to name him.
Mr. Marquina the Bear and later on would send him letters and post cards. In 1987 Dalí donated the teddy bear to the Museu del Joguet in Figueres where, still today, it occupies a special place in that toy museum.
